SVN offers different types of training opportunities:

  • 24-Hour Certificate: This program will specifically meet the 24 hours of training required of SVN members as detailed in the SVN standards HERE.  A formal certificate program is a form of credentialing, but it is not certification. For more information about the history of the certificate, and training go HERE.
  • Administrative (Program Management) Certificate: This program will specifically meet the 16 hours of training required of program leadership as detailed in the SVN standards HERE. A formal certificate program is a form of credentialing, but it is not certification. 
  • Supportive Supervised Visitation Certificate: This program will specifically meet the 2023 revised training standards required by SVN Standard 12.6 for Supportive Supervised Visitation. Learn more HERE. A formal certificate program is a form of credentials, but is not certification. 
What is a certificate training? 
  • Nurturing Parenting Skills for Families in Supervised Visitation- is an innovative program designed to empower parents and parent educators in creating customized, competency-based parenting programs to meet the specific needs of families in supervised visitation. It consists of 45 lessons, each lasting approximately 30 minutes that are intended to either precede a supervised visitation or be incorporated into the visit.

  • Online Training: Our Key Concepts Training is an 8-hour, train-at-your-pace, program covering the fundamental concepts of Supervised Visitation.  Learn more HERE

This training meets SVN Standard 12.6 for Supportive Supervised Visitation: 

12.6 Training for Supportive Supervision
In addition to the SVN 24-hour training standard, a visit supervisor providing supportive visitation must complete additional training on the following topics:

  • Child Development
  • Trauma-informed interventions to promote (change;) positive visits.
  • Parenting skills
  • Communication Skills
  • Behaviors that facilitate positive attachment, separation, and reconnection
